The CouRT (ThRüston, J., absent,) appointed Dr. Laurie, committee. The Act of Maryland, 1785, c. 72, § 6, authorizes the Chancellor to superintend the affairs of lunatics, and to appoint a committee, &c., but does not direct the mode of ascertaining who are lunatics. This must be done by a writ in the nature of a writ de lunático inquirendo, which issues by order of the Court upon affidavit.
